The Buffalo Family Introduces a New Family Member

It is with great excitement that we introduce you to our newest Buffalo family member. The Board of Trustees held a special meeting on Monday, April 24th  during which they named Mr. Steve Morrow the next Principal at Lone Oak High School. 

Steve Morrow - Lone Oak High School Principal

 

 Mr. Morrow is an outstanding educator that has been working in and around schools for 18 years. Mr. Morrow is moving to Texas from Florida where he has spent the last two years as an educational consultant. His passion for education has led him across the US from Texas to Alaska to Florida, and he is thrilled to be returning to the great State of Texas. He looks forward to joining the Buffalo family along with his wife, Erin, and his three children, Luke (14), Cheyenne (11), and Hunter (8). 

 
Mr. Morrow intends on jumping in head first to his new duties as soon as he and his family make the big move from Florida to Texas mid-summer. He looks forward to getting to know each and every team member on his campus and within the district and joining our small town community, that always puts family first.  
 
This change in leadership came about after the March board meeting where the Board of Trustees approved our current High School Principal, Mr. Compton, to be the new Director of Finance and Operations in the Administration Office.
